Men's Basketball Fall to Anna Maria 88-79

The Anna Maria College AMCATS defeated the Suffolk University Men's Basketball team 88-79 in Great Northeast Athletic Conference (GNAC) action on Tuesday evening at the Regan Gymnasium.

Junior Branden Barboza (Riverside, R.I.) led all players scoring 27 points to pace the Rams offense, who fall to 8-15 on the season with the setback.

Five different AMCATS scored in double-digit scoring totals as junior Patrick Bradanese (Billerica, Mass.) led the way with 21 points. Graduate student Quantez Franklin (South Yarmouth, Mass.) chipped in with 17 points, followed by junior Tyler Delorey (Worcester, Mass.) adding 13.

Suffolk took a 42-40 lead into the break with them highlighted by an 11-point first half performance by sophomore Matt Duquette (Swamspcott, Mass.).

Both teams would trade leads for more than half of the second period until Franklin put the AMCATS up by a pair, 67-65 with 8:09 remaining in the game for good.

Delorey would score all 13 of his game's points in the second half for the AMCATS who improve to 14-10 on the year and 12-5 in conference.

Junior Adam Chick (Northbrook, Ill.) narrowly missed a triple-double on the night as he finished leading all players with 13 rebounds, scoring 10 points while also recording six assists.

Junior Jake Meister (Madison, N.J.) also scored 15 points on the night for Suffolk.

Anna Maria will round out their 2014-15 regular season on Saturday afternoon when they host Albertus Magnus College.

Suffolk will host Lasell College on Thursday evening at 7:00pm in the home finale before wrapping things up on Saturday when they travel to Emmanuel College.
